This series commemorates my 50+ years of snowmobiling and the 20 snowmobiles my family and I had fun on during that time. In 1967, our family started snowmobiling in Syracuse, New York. Back then we would ride on Oneida Lake, or any field we could get permission to ride on. A special thanks to Mark & Glenn for helping me with this series.

This was our 15th sled. We purchased it new, just after we purchased the Indy Lite 340 Deluxe. The Indy Trail Deluxe was our first “2-up touring” sled. It had a 440cc fan-cooled engine producing about 50 horsepower. The first time we took it on Houghton Lake, the top speed was about 65 mph for a short distance, then it would drop to about 40 mph. At the same time, I noticed the smell of burning plastic. That smell turned out to be the hyfax overheating. We then realized that the track was adjusted too tight from the dealer. We loosened it up a bit and then it would easily do 65+ mph with 2 people onboard all the way across the lake. I believe this was also the first sled I rode from St. Helen to the “Tip-Up Town Festival” in Houghton Lake Michigan.
